Students have lots of options to chooose from today when trying to decide which college to attend. College Factual has developed its “Schools Highly Focused on Law Major in the Southwest Region” ranking as one item you can use to help make this decision.
In 2021-2022, 36,411 people earned their degree in law, making the major the 21st most popular in the United States.
Across the Southwest region, there were 2,966 law gra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ively.
For this year’s “Schools Highly Focused on Law Major in the Southwest Region” ranking, we looked at 16 colleges that offer a degree in law. The colleges and universities that top this list are recognized because their law program is one of the largest majors offered at the school.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end South Texas College of Law. It ranked #1 on our 2023 Schools Highly Focused on Law Major in the Southwest Region list. This small school is located in Houston, Texas, and it awarded 297 ’s law degrees in 2021-2022.
The low undergrad student loan default rate of 0.3%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. The undergraduate student-to-faculty ratio of to 1 is a sign that students will have more opportunities to engage with their professors one-on-one.
